Transaction 61f228bb45436460570cf76b07e05fd31750e89591aa66686403da076433be07
1 Input
1 Output
-
61f228bb45436460570cf76b07e05fd31750e89591aa66686403da076433be07:0
- value
- 304975
- script pubkey
- OP_0 OP_PUSHBYTES_20 aebe01675e589a8ed7c942794adb68efa21e8140
- address
- bc1q46lqze67tzdga47fgfu54kmga73paq2quxc2wd